  • 30W USB C Charger: With 30W max output, this foldable 30W USB C charger charges most devices more efficiently. For example, it charges the iPhone 14 series up to 3× faster than with an original 5W charger, iPad Pro 12.9"(2020) can be fully charged in 139mins, which is much faster than the original adapter(207mins).
  • Advanced GaN II Technology: Thanks to the latest GaN II Technology, the foldable 30W USB C charger is much smaller in size with a 20% increase in operating frequency, an innovative stacked design, and an upgraded circuit board structure.
  • Multiple Fast Charge Choices: The 30W GaN USB C Charger supports PD 3.0/2.0 QC 4.0/3.0/2.0 PPS and BC 1.2 fast charge protocols, and charges most devices at a quite fast speed. Upgraded with a 30W output so you can charge your phone, tablet, earbuds, and even your MacBook Air with such a tiny charger.
  • Universal Compatibility: This 30W PD USB C fast Charger is compatible with Macbook 13'', MacBook Air, Macbook Pro 13, iPad Air 5, iPad Pro, iPhone 14 Pro Max/14 Pro/14 /13 Pro Max/13/12/SE 3/11/XS/X, Galaxy S23/S22/S21/S20/S10/Note 10/A53, Google Pixel 7/6/5/4, Xiaomi mi 11, Huawei P40/P30, Redmi Note 10, Moto G30, Nokia 8, Switch, etc.
  • Safer Charging: Built-in multi-protection, this 30W USB C Charger protects your device away from over-voltage, over-heating, short-circuiting, etc which ensures the safety of you and your devices.

    Actual output voltages:
    5v 3a
    9v 3a
    12v 2.5a
    15v 2a
    20v 1.5a
